The clinical area identified by the Philippine College of Surgeons (PCS) for the third evidence-based clinical practice guidelines (EBCPGs) was on the management of breast cancer. Funding for the research project was provided by the Philippine Council for Health Research and Development (PCHRD), and a Technical Working Group (TWG) was formed, composed of 5 general surgeons and 1 medical oncologist. The TWG was tasked to identify the clinical questions and to adhere to the PCS approved method of developing EBCPGs. The TWG decided to divide the report into two parts: Early Breast Cancer, and Locally Advanced and Metastatic Breast Cancer. This first report will focus on Early Breast Cancer The definition of early breast cancer is that used by the Early Breast Cancer Trialists Collaborative Group (EBCTG), since the regular systemic reviews (meta-analysis) of the group on the primary and adjuvant therapies of early breast cancer currently comprise the strongest evidence. "In women with "early breast cancer", all detectable cancer is, by definition, restricted to the breast and, in the case of node positive patients, the local lymph nodes can be removed surgically." The TWG began work on July 1, 2000. The literature search, limited to English publications, used both electronic and manual methods. Three electronic databases were used: 1) The Cochrane library, Issue 2, 2000; 2) National Library of Medicine-Medline (PubMed, no time limit); and HERDIN (Health Research and Development Information Network) Version 1, 1997 of DOST-PCHRD Titles of all articles were printed and at least 2 members of the TWG went over the list and checked the titles of articles whose abstract they felt should be read. The abstracts of all checked articles were printed. The printed abstracts were given to the members of the TWG, who then decided which articles were to be included for full text retrieval. The full texts were obtained from the University of the Philippines Manila Library, and were appraised using standard forms. The TWG then compiled, summarized and classified the evidence according to 3 levels and proposed a first draft to recommendations according to 3 categories.(Author)

4.Application of the Sleep C.A.L.M. Tool for Assessing Nocturia in a Large Nationally Representative Cohort
Joseph U. BORODA ; Benjamin De LEON ; Lakshay KHOSLA ; Muchi D. CHOBUFO ; Syed N. RAHMAN ; Jason M. LAZAR ; Jeffrey P. WEISS ; Thomas F. MONAGHAN
International Neurourology Journal 2024;28(Suppl 1):55-61
Purpose:
Nocturia significantly impacts patients’ quality of life but remains insufficiently evaluated and treated. The “Sleep C.A.L.M.” system categorizes the factors thought to collectively reflect most underlying causes of nocturia (Sleep disorders, Comorbidities, Actions [i.e., modifiable patient behaviors such as excess fluid intake], Lower urinary tract dysfunction, and Medications). The purpose of this study was to assess the association of nocturia with the Sleep C.A.L.M. categories using a nationally representative dataset.
Methods:
Retrospective analysis of the National Health and Nutrition Examination Survey from 2013/14–2017/18 cycles was conducted. Pertinent questionnaire, laboratory, dietary, and physical examination data were used to ascertain the presence of Sleep C.A.L.M. categories in adults ≥20 years of age. Nocturia was defined as ≥2 nighttime voids.
Results:
A total of 12,274 included subjects were included (51.6% female; median age, 49.0 years [interquartile range, 34.0–62.0 years]; 27.6% nocturia). Among subjects with nocturia, the prevalence of 0, ≥1, and ≥2 Sleep C.A.L.M. categories was 3.5% (95% confidence interval [CI], 2.8%–4.4%), 96.5% (95% CI, 95.6%–97.2%), and 81.2% (95% CI, 78.9%–83.3%), respectively. Compared to those with 0–1 Sleep C.A.L.M. categories, the adjusted odds of nocturia in subjects with 2, 3, and 4–5 Sleep C. A.L.M. categories were 1.77 (95% CI, 1.43–2.21), 2.33 (1.89–2.87), and 3.49 (2.81–4.35), respectively (P<0.001). Similar trends were observed for most age and sex subgroups. When assessed individually, each of the 5 Sleep C.A.L.M. categories were independently associated with greater odds of nocturia, which likewise persisted across multiple age and sex subgroups.
Conclusions
Sleep C.A.L.M. burden is associated with increased odds of nocturia in a dose-dependent fashion, and potentially a relevant means by which to organize the underlying etiologies for nocturia among community-dwelling adults.
5.Pressure ulcer prevention in acute care using the pressure ulcer bundle of care.
Josephine M. De Leon ; Sheila Mae Dote ; Shana Lou M. Mendez ; Mikka D. Gillera ; Hanna Jean J. Natnat ; Ryan Gabriel D. Jose
Philippine Journal of Nursing 2015;85(1):59-68
A study was conducted to determine the effectiveness of the pressure ulcer bundle of care (PUB) in preventing pressure ulcers among patients in acute care. The pre and post-test quasi-experimental design was utilized to predict a model of preventing pressure ulcer in acute care setting. Thirty acute care patients with moderate risk for pressure ulcers were randomly selected to receive the following five PUB interventions: assessment of pressure ulcer risk, repositioning, head elevation, heel elevation, and frequent diet monitoring. Pressure ulcer risk was assessed using the Braden risk assessment scale before and after PUB interventions. This scale assesses important aspects of ulcer formation according to six subscales: sensory perception, moisture, mobility, physical activity, nutrition, and friction/shear. Profile of the patients according to age, sex, and length of hospital stay was described using frequency and percentage distribution. Bundle compliance, as measured by performance of the five interventions was described using mean scores and standard deviations. The t-test was used to determine the differences in pressure ulcer risk or occurrence between pre- and post-intervention phases. Multiple linear regression analysis was used to determine the relationship of Pressure Ulcer Risk Assessment Scores (PURAS) to the PUB, and to identify the predictor(s) of PURAS among the four interventions in the PUB. Statistical significance was considered at the .05 level. Pressure ulcer risk scores of patients improved significantly from "mild risk" to "not a risk" post-PUB (p=<0.001). Head elevation, heel elevation, and diet monitoring were found to be predictors of pressure ulcer risk scores after PUB interventions. Repositioning was not significantly associated with pressure ulcer risk scores of patients after PUB interventions. The three predictor model revealed the PUB interventions were able to account for 52% of the variance in pressure ulcer risk scores, which indicates a strong significant relationship between patients receiving PUB and their improvement in pressure ulcer risk. In conclusion, the pressure ulcer bundle of care intervention is effective in prevention of pressure ulcers in patients at risk. Nurses should adopt the provision of bundle of care intervention(s) to enhance patient safety and quality of care.

8.Cross-sectional study on the correlation of stress and sleep quality of Learning Unit III (1st Year) to VII (5th Year) medical students from the University of the Philippines College of Medicine.
Trisha M. Ballebas ; Jasmine Q. Maraon ; Ciara O. Janer ; Pamela S. Irisari ; Leener Kaye B. Alucilja ; Lance Adrian T. Ko ; Khayria G. Minalang ; Abiel S. De Leon ; Francis Ruel G. Castillo ; Edrian M. Octavo ; Alexis O. Bacolongan ; Camilo C. Roa Jr. ; Eric Oliver D. Sison
Acta Medica Philippina 2024;58(14):41-49
BACKGROUND AND OBJECTIVE
Due to their academic load, medical students are highly susceptible to stress. Stress is one of the factors that can alter sleep quality which may consequently affect the cognitive performance of medical students. There has been a lack of published local literature that looks into the association between stress and sleep quality, especially during the COVID-19 pandemic. With this, the general objective of this study is to determine the effect of stress on the sleep quality of medical students from the University of the Philippines Manila - College of Medicine (UPCM).
METHODSA cross-sectional study was conducted using a stratified random sample of 273 males and females of Learning Unit (LU) III (1st year) to VII (5th year) medical students from a college of medicine based in the Philippines, UPCM, during the second semester of the academic year 2021-2022. A self-administered questionnaire was distributed to assess sleep quality using the Pittsburgh Sleep Quality Index (PSQI), and stress level using the Kessler Psychological Distress Scale (K10). Kruskal-Wallis was used to test statistical differences between stress scores and the sleep quality of students from different year levels. Spearman's Rho was used to determine the correlation between stress and sleep, and a binary logistic regression was employed to study the association of stress with sleep while accounting for confounding variables namely caffeine intake, year level, daytime nap, duty hours, clinical rotation, sex, and age.
A high prevalence of stress (79.71%) and poor sleep quality (59.73%) among LU III to LU VII UPCM students were found, with a statistically positive correlation (⍴=0.44) 95CI [0.33-0.55] (p-value < 0.001). Both the stress scores and sleep quality indices were not statistically significantly different across LUs. Gathered data and interpreted results showed that medical students suffering from stress are more likely to have poor sleep quality, which can lead to low academic performance and high susceptibility to chronic diseases, compared to those medical students with low levels of stress. Only being an LU IV [OR=1.38 95CI (0.036-4.625)] and LU V [OR=2.13 95CI (0.296-6.936)] student had increased odds of having poor sleep quality compared to LU III students. Caffeine intake, daytime nap, duty hours, clinical rotation, sex, and age were not associated with poor sleep quality.
CONCLUSIONThis study documents a statistically significant association between stress and poor sleep quality among LU III to LU VII UPCM students. A larger study covering multiple medical schools in the Philippines may be of merit for future investigations to generate nationwide data. Additional recommendations include: a) conducting a cross-sectional or a longitudinal study to detect changes in the characteristics of the population, b) observing the differences in the contributing factors at multiple points throughout the year, c) investigating the effect of dwelling set-up on sleep quality may also be investigated and d) determining if sleep quality affects the level of perceived stress of medical students.

9.Proposed case rates for acute coronary syndrome and budget impact analysis: Executive summary
Bernadette A. Tumanan-Mendoza ; Victor L. Mendoza ; Felix Eduardo R. Punzalan ; Noemi S. Pestañ ; o ; April Ann A. Bermudez-de los Santos ; Eric Oliver D. Sison ; Eugenio B. Reyes ; Karen Amoloza-de Leon ; Nashiba M. Daud ; Maria Grethel C. Dimalala-Lardizaba ; Orlando R. Bugarin ; Rodney M. Jimenez ; Domicias L. Albacite ; Ma. Belen A. Balagapo ; Elfred M. Batalla ; Jonathan James G. Bernardo ; Helen Ong Garcia ; Amibahar J. Karim ; Gloria R. Lahoz ; Neil Wayne C. Salces
Philippine Journal of Cardiology 2022;50(2):10-15
BACKGROUND
Coronary artery disease is the leading cause of death in the Philippines and can present as acute coronary syndrome. Hospitalization for ACS has epidemiologic and economic burden. In fact, last 2017, there were 1.52% or 152 admissions for every 10,000 hospitalized patients for medical conditions in PhilHealth-accredited hospitals locally. However, coronary angioplasty was performed in only less than 1% of these cases mainly because of its cost and the out-of-pocket expense that the treatment entail, when primary percutaneous intervention has been proven to be effective in reducing mortality in STEMI and early invasive intervention performed during index hospitalization for NSTEMI is likewise recommended. Moreover, there is a big disparity between the current case rates for ACS for medical therapy alone and for invasive intervention compared to the actual ACS hospitalization cost.
OBJECTIVES1) To propose revisions to the current PhilHealth case rates for acute coronary syndrome (ACS); and 2) To determine the budget impact of the proposed ACS case rates.
METHODSThe Philippine Heart Association with the assistance of a technical working group undertook the study. A panel of experts composed of general and invasive cardiologists from Luzon, Visayas, and Mindanao was formed. The ACS hospitalization costs based on the recent study by Mendoza were presented and discussed during the focus group discussions with the panelists. Issues pertinent to their localities that may affect the costs were discussed. The proposed revised costs on the particular ACS conditions and therapeutic regimens were then voted and agreed upon. A budget impact analysis of the proposed case rates was then performed.
RESULTSThe proposed case rates for ACS ranged from Php 80,000 (for low risk unstable angina given medical treatment) to Php 530,000 (for ST-elevation myocardial infarction initially given a thrombolytic agent then underwent PCI which necessitated the use of three stents). The budget impact analysis showed that the proposed ACS rates would require an additional PHP 1.5 billion to 2.3 billion during the first year of a 3- versus 5-year implementation period, respectively. The period of implementation will be affected by budgetary constraints as well as the availability of cardiac catheterization facilities in the country.
CONCLUSIONThe proposed revised PhilHealth hospitalization coverage for ACS is more reflective or realistic of the ACS hospitalization costs in contrast with the current PhilHealth case rates. The corresponding budget impact analysis of these proposed case rates showed that PHP 7.6 billion is needed for full implementation. However, given the budget constraints, the percentage of the total costs for the first and subsequent years of implementation may be modified.
10.Revised PhilHealth case rates for hospitalization for acute coronary syndrome in the Philippines
Felix Eduardo R. Punzalan ; Noemi S. Pestañ ; o ; April Ann A. Bermudez-delos Santos ; Bernadette A. Tumanan-Mendoza ; Victor L. Mendoza ; Eric Oliver D. Sison ; Karen Amoloza-De Leon ; Eugenio B. Reyes ; Nashiba M. Daud ; Maria Grethel C. Dimalala-Lardizabal ; Orlando R. Bugarin ; Rodney M. Jimenez ; Domicias L. Albacite ; Ma. Belen A. Balagapo ; Elfred M. Batalla ; Jonathan James G. Bernardo ; Helen Ong Garcia ; Amibahar J. Karim ; Gloria R. Lahoz ; Neil Wayne C. Salces
Philippine Journal of Cardiology 2022;50(2):16-25
BACKGROUND
Hospitalization for acute coronary syndrome (ACS) has epidemiologic and economic burden. The coverage for hospitalization in the local setting is much less than the actual costs. Many patients do not consent to or avail of the optimal and timely management because of financial challenges.
OBJECTIVESThe paper aimed to propose revised PhilHealth case rates/packages for ACS, namely: 1) unstable angina (UA), 2) non-ST-elevation myocardial infarction (NSTEMI), and 3) STelevation myocardial infarction (STEMI).
METHODSA consensus panel was organized to provide inputs such as cost and other matters pertaining to the revision of the PhilHealth ACS case rates/packages. The results of the cost of hospitalization of the different ACS conditions derived from a study on hospitalization cost for ACS were presented to the panel. Several focused group discussions were held afterward for propositioning new case rates through votation and by nominal group technique, using the costs from the study as the bases of rate adjustment.
RESULTSFinal costs agreed upon by the consensus panel for medical management alone for UA, NSTEMI, and STEMI were adjusted or amended in increments of Php 20,000, (80,000, 100,000, and 120,000, respectively). Thrombolysis of a patient admitted for STEMI increased the cost to Php 140,000. An additional cost of Php 150,000 was added on top of the cost for medical management and coronary angiogram for NSTE- ACS for PCI with use of a single stent. For STEMI, the same category had an additional cost of Php 180,000. For each additional stent used for all clinical scenarios undergoing PCI, Php 65,000 was added, to cover up to a total of 3 stents.
CONCLUSIONBased on the consensus process with Philippine Heart Association ACS panelists, the cost proposed ranges from 80,000 pesos to 530,000 pesos depending on the clinical scenarios.
